Packaging


Aside from the mouse, one finds a braided charging cable (USB Type-A to Type-C), rubber extension cable (USB Type-A to Micro-USB), wireless dongle, quick start guide, plastic stick, set of grip tape, sticker, replacement battery (300 mAh capacity), and several sets of replacement feet (regular set and two sets of dots) inside the box.

Weight


My scale shows around 43 g (+/- 1 g), which is exactly in line with the weight cited by G-Wolves. The HTX 4K weighs 8 g less than the Hati-S Plus 4K, which has a much larger battery, and 3 g less than the Hati-S Plus ACE, which has a slightly smaller battery. Accordingly, the HTX 4K is currently among the absolute lightest wireless mice available, and the lightest one with a solid top shell. An excellent weight.

Cable


The HTX 4K comes with a braided charging cable (USB Type-A to Type-C) along with a rubber extension cable (USB Type-A to Micro-USB). The rubber cable has stronger shielding and is exclusively used for connecting the dongle. On the extension cable, the connector has two horizontal notches that slot into the shell for further stabilization, which is absent on the charging cable. Since the notches are present on the connector instead of the mouse, using a third-party Micro-USB cable is perfectly possible. In terms of flexibility, neither cable is particularly flexible, and the braided cable is both shorter and stiffer than the braided charging cable included with the Hati-S Plus 4K and ACE. The measured length of the braided cable is 1.45 m, whereas the rubber one measures 0.95 m.

Feet


The feet on the HTX 4K are white-dyed pure PTFE (Teflon) feet. They are of average thickness and have slightly rounded edges. Glide is very good. Since the bottom shell lacks indents for the feet, replacement feet of virtually any size and shape can be used, and several such sets are included in the box already. While a sensor ring is not installed by default, one is included with the replacement sets.
